AEW taped its Grand Slam: Australia special this morning in Brisbane. The show will air on TNT after the NBA All-Star game. Here are the spoilers, courtesy of PWInsider.com:
- Will Ospreay & Kenny Omega vs. Konosuke Takeshita & Kyle Fletcher: Omega and Ospreay won after a combination of the One-Winged Angel and Blade Runner on Takeshita.
- TBS Championship Match: Mercedes Mone (c) vs. Harley Cameron: Mone retained her title with the Money Maker.
- Brisbane Brawl: Jon Moxley & Claudio Castagnoli vs. Jay White & Adam Copeland: Moxley choked out Copeland for the victory.
- AEW Revolution Announcements: A video package promoted Will Ospreay vs. Kyle Fletcher in a steel cage match and Kenny Omega vs. Konosuke Takeshita for the International Championship at AEW Revolution.
- Continental Championship Match: Kazuchika Okada (c) vs. Buddy Matthews: Okada retained his title after a low blow and a Rainmaker.
- AEW Return to Australia: An announcement confirmed AEW’s return to Australia in 2026.
- AEW Women’s World Championship Match: Toni Storm (c) vs. Mariah May: Storm won the title after hitting Storm Zero. May had earlier used her own version of the move.
